Over 800 members of the South African Police Force took part in a crowd control exercise at the newly completed 2010 Soccer World Cup stadium in Port Elizabeth, South Africa. Here a formation of police in their riot gear are is seen standing at one of the entrances to the Nelson Mandela Bay (Port Elizabeth) Stadium. In influx of international visitors is expected for the June 2010 event.
